after some research i was found that my problem was about using swagger along with OData in .NetCore2.1. In addition to its Swagger 2.0 and OpenAPI 3.0 generator, Swashbuckle also provides an embedded version of the awesome swagger-ui that's . Definitions Resource. Clinic located in Orange City, specialized in Pain Control, Headache, Migraine, Menstrual Problems, Menopausal Syndrome, and Infertility - (818) 923-6345. . Swagger UI - renders OpenAPI specs as interactive API documentation. Configuring the Swagger Middleware. Swagger.png. . Swagger RESTful Web . application.yml base-package ,. .NET Core 3.1Swagger CC BY-SA 4.0 ICP19005194-3 I keep getting "no operations defined in spec" although my controllers are correctly constructed. The Swagger UI will be displayed with updated value of Employee model as below. Follow edited Jan 13, 2019 at 20:42. swaggerNo operations defined in spec! c# swagger asp.net-core-2.1.net-core-2.1. New video coming on Monday no operations defined in spec swagger python. 3. routerswaggerdocs Firstly, install a package of 'NSwag.AspNetCore' v11.15.3 onto your API project. What is Swagger Specification & Swagger UI. To bring Swagger up and running in .Net Core 2.2 API project will just cost you a 5-minute with the following 2 steps but its power is priceless. Swagger /** * Swagger */ @Configuration @Enable Swagger 2 @Profile ( {"dev", "test . ASP.NET API Versioning. The Swagger UI now clearly documents the expected HTTP response codes: In ASP.NET Core 2.2 or later, conventions can be used as an alternative to explicitly decorating individual actions with [ProducesResponseType]. Atualize o Microsoft Edge para aproveitar os recursos, o suporte tcnico e as atualizaes de segurana mais recentes. Swagger UI. "services.AddSwaggerGen (c =>" : Swagger .Net Core ortamnda belli configurasyonlar ile tanmlanr. java. No operations defined in . Dale K. The swagger-core output is compliant with Swagger Specification. Swagger UI offers a web-based UI that provides information about the service, using the generated OpenAPI specification. sandy munro net worth 2020; salat mit weintrauben und cashewkerne; . It is probably becoming as the main standard for this domain (APIs description metadata). i did not find explicitly is it should be like that for sure (but default Microsoft template uses this SDK in .net core 2.2) so it would be great if someone could explain why .Web SDK needs to be used after migration from .net core 2.1 to 2.2 Everything works fine, except swagger. spring. Yes, the UI loads with the error: "No Operations defined in spec!" and when clicking the JSON link it gives back a file created with empty paths: {} so the UI loads as expected and is accessible on the path expected but it doesn't populate the UI or JSON file with any of . Share. In brief, this OpenAPI tutorial is unique in the following ways: This OpenAPI tutorial shows the spec in context of a simple weather API introduced earlier in this course. Previous Article Spice up your giros!!! I found your example project in the samples. Could it be 5.0 combability i. // Register the Swagger generator, defining 1 or more Swagger documents. SqlServer5 1. 2. 3. The major Swagger tools include: Swagger Editor - browser-based editor where you can write OpenAPI specs. swagger no operations defined in spec! Create a WebAPI sample service and Swashbuckle nuget package. Swagger. Previous Article Spice up your giros!!! For more information, see Use web API conventions. .NET Core 3.1Swagger CC BY-SA 4.0 ICP19005194-3 spring swagger no operations defined in spec! Swagger tooling for APIs built with ASP.NET Core. swagger2 No operations defined in spec!. abri couvert non clos 2020; lettre de motivation licence droit conomie gestion mention droit; compositeur italien 4 lettres luigi @mikebeaton thanks for deep investigation.. i liked the way you checked the issue. No operations defined in spec.png. Publicado 3 anos atrs, em 23/08/2019. If the UI opens, you can click on the swagger.json link under the title. asp.net core swagger - - . Step 2: Select the API as the project template. 1. API . Swashbuckle.AspNetCore. On July 2017, the OpenAPI Specification 3.0.0 was finally released by the Open API Initiative. The next step is to configure the Swagger Middleware. One can use any version of .NET Core like 2.2 or 3.0 etc. Programao; Java API; Spring Boot API Rest: Segurana da API, Cache e Monitoramento . spring swagger no operations defined in spec! Step 1: Create an ASP.NET Core Web API project in Visual Studio 2019. Before diving into the first step of the OpenAPI tutorial here, read the OpenAPI tutorial overview (if you haven't already) to get a sense of the scope of this tutorial. Select .Net Core 2.2 (or later) from the drop-down list at the top. So generator doesn't discover api in the dll. Step 3: Install the NuGet Package - Swashbuckle.AspNetCore. No operations defined in spec!swagger . Hi I am using version 6.1.3 with .net core 5.0 web api project. In this article, we will understand the Swagger interfaces IOperationFilter and IDocumentFilter in ASP.NET Core 3.1 services introduced based on OpenAPI specification i.e swagger v3.0. package br.com.alura.forum.config.swagger; I was already aware of Swagger - which actually released a Swagger 2.0 version -, though I must say I was glad to find a "Web API oriented Swagger" version with no dependency on ASP.NET MVC. My implementation of Swagger is giving me "No operations defined in spec!". Hmmm sounds cool, so I gave it a try [based on your instructions] and as usual, I must say things went straight forward with no ambiguities. if yes maybe you can fork my demo repository and push changes i would create issue to Microsoft.AspNetCore.Mvc.ApiExplorer repository (by providing them debuggable Swashbuckle example) maybe they will help to . : : (:api)!. No operations defined in specswagger2No operations defined in spec! For this post, I have used Visual Studio 2019 and ASP.NET Core 3.1 Web API project template. The web UI looks like this: Swagger is a set of open-source tools built around the OpenAPI Specification that can help you design, build, document and consume REST APIs. erro no swagger No operations defined in spec! RESTFUL + . Summary. What Is Swagger? Over the past few years, Swagger has become the standard for defining or documenting your API. Swagger In .NET Core. No operations defined in spec swagger2No operations defined in spec! After competing generating client using Swagger Specification and consuming it, next, we are going to have a look at another way of generating client code using "ASP.Net core via API Explorer". swagger no operations defined in spec! Once we add the NuGet package to the project, we will configure Swagger . GINswaggerFailed to load spec. Maybe you still have compiling code with Swashbuckle.AspNetCore added as project instead of nuget ? Generate beautiful API documentation, including a UI to explore and test operations, directly from your routes, controllers and models. Secondly, add Swagger services in 'Startup.cs' file for 'ConfigureServices' and 'Configure' methods. Swagger UI offers a web-based UI that provides information about the service, using the generated OpenAPI specification. Swagger2 No operations defined in spec! It is up to the specification user to decide whether sub-resources should be referred to as part of their main resource or as a resource of their own. aps criar a classe do swagger configuration ele da o erro No operations defined in spec! i found a solution for this problem. Springbootswagger swagger io.spr in gfox spr in gfox- swagger 2 2.7.0 io.spr in gfox spr in gfox- swagger -ui 2.7.0 2.7.0. segue a classe. Messix_1102 .Net Core MVC swaggerNo operations defined in spec! New video coming on Monday I already talked about these two interfaces in my previous article supporting ASP.NET Core 2.2 which was based on swagger v2.0 specification. A resource in Swagger is an entity that has a set of exposed operations. swagger . Yeah, sorry. In this article, we will explore all Swagger core annotations used for RESTFul API Documentation in Java. swaggerNo operations defined in spec! Using Visual Studio 16.10 or later, create a new Azure Functions project and choose the HttpTrigger template - "Http Trigger with OpenAPI". The web UI looks like this: The heart of Swagger is the Swagger Specification (API description metadata which is a JSON or YAML file). Paste the shortcode from one of the relevant plugins here in order to enable logging in with social networks. No tag "" defined in tag library imported with prefix "ww" No operators . SqlServer5. May 31, 2022; alain chamfort lucas chamfort; strawberry spring stephen king pdf Saiba como adicionar o Swashbuckle ao seu projeto de API Web ASP.NET Core para integrar a interface do usurio do Swagger. Swashbuckle . What is Swagger. In short: i needed to change my HOST project SDK: from 'Microsoft.NET.Sdk' to 'Microsoft.NET.Sdk.Web'. Formerly known as the Swagger Specification, this format has been donated to the Open API Initiative (or OAI) which is a Linux Foundation Collaborative Project. I got following message (and no endpoints) on my swagger page: "No operations defined in spec!" swagger . For ASP.Net Core, we will add the NuGet package Swashbuckle.AspNetCore in our project. Integrating Swagger UI in the ASP.NET Core Web API application. . Unfortunately it does not work and I just see No operations defined in spec! Let's make the following changes in the ConfigureServices () method of the Startup.cs class: public void ConfigureServices(IServiceCollection services) {. Please add below Swashbuckle NuGet package to your WebAPI using Command prompt or package manager console. No h mais suporte para esse navegador. "c.SwaggerDoc ("CoreSwagger", new Info" : CoreSwagger ad ile . immediate shutdown in progress - no operations are permitted; spec006 ; pip install jupyterValueError: ('Expected version spec in', 'widgetsnbextension ~=3.4.0',.) Getting Started. About; Products For Teams; Stack Overflow Public questions & answers; Stack . The entity can represent an actual object (pets, users..) or a set of logical operations collated together. :swagger,::No operations defined in spec!:: (:api)!:1.swaggercontroller(), . Swagger UI. The NuGet package Swashbuckle provides the implementation of Swagger or OpenAPI Specification in .Net. Over that, we use Consign to handle the starting of the server. NSwag example with ASP.Net core via API Explorer. first i added two following Nuget packages: These packages make it very easy and elegant to introduce versioning semantics to an API. swagger no operations defined in spec! In order to generate the Swagger documentation, swagger-core offers a set of annotations to declare and manipulate the output. swaggerNo operations defined in spec! One of the best ways to version a .NET API is to go to aspnet-api-versioning repo and use a package that's suitable to your Web API version. Swashbuckle.AspNetCore.Swagger: Swagger SwaggerDocument JSON.. Swashbuckle.AspNetCore.SwaggerGen: Swagger, . 2: you need to enable XML Documentation file under project obtions => Build tab. Avanar para o contedo principal. Adding swagger definition in .NET Core (2.0 and above) is simply a 2-3 steps process. Swagger UI also helps in maintaining well up-to-date documentation of the APIs. My problem is that I've started a React Native project that needs to consume my own API, but we're using ES6 javascripts with this stack: MERN (MySQL, Express, React, Nodejs). swagger . .Net Core MVC swaggerNo operations defined in spec! abri couvert non clos 2020; lettre de motivation licence droit conomie gestion mention droit; compositeur italien 4 lettres luigi Secondly, add Swagger services in 'Startup.cs' file for 'ConfigureServices' and 'Configure' methods. Now we are going to try the second way of generating client code using ASP.Net core via API Explorer. Swagger is a very much used open source framework backed by a large ecosystem of tools that helps you design, build, document, and consume your RESTful APIs. With the many . : swagger ,:: No operations defined in spec! At the time of writing this blog, the version of Swashbuckle.AspNetCore is 5.4.0. To bring Swagger up and running in .Net Core 2.2 API project will just cost you a 5-minute with the following 2 steps but its power is priceless. For my experiments I've been using the sample project based on ASP.NET Core. In this article, we have learned about the following topics, Why API documentation is needed. net core 2.2 normal This problem occurred after upgrading to 3.0. services.AddSwaggerGen(options => {options.SwaggerDoc("v2", new OpenApiInfo Choose the name and location for your new project and click on create button. Open Visual Studio and select "Create new project. Swagger,No operations defined in spec! Each annotation also has links to its . Select ASP.Net Core Web Application from the templates displayed. asp.net core apiapi. Categories. : 1. swagger controller . In my case, the issue was / is a bit more complex as I'm mixing HTTP1 ("The old controllers") and HTTP2 calls (GRPC services) on the same endpoint while also having another endpoint where only certain calls should be possible (I wanted to use the minimal API here, but I don't beleive that it's working like that in the concrete scenario). private static string [] XmlCommentsFilePath { get { var basePath = PlatformServices.Default.Application.ApplicationBasePath; var apiDocFile = typeof (Startup . Firstly, install a package of 'NSwag.AspNetCore' v11.15.3 onto your API project. spring. Swagger No operations defined in spec 1. ; This OpenAPI tutorial shows how the spec . Then you need to read this file through swagger so that swagger can create documentation from it. Customize and Extending the Swagger Documentation. In my configure services if i add these services.AddVersionedApiExplorer(); it will break the swagger and saw us swagger with &#39;No operations defined in spec!&#39; if i comment out this code it . spring. in the sw. Stack Overflow. Both Swashbuckle and NSwag include an embedded version of Swagger UI, so that it can be hosted in your ASP.NET Core app using a middleware registration call. I'm implementing Namespaceversioning for my application. Brady Gaster showed the benefit of a well-designed API using ASP.NET Core and OpenAPI in this post on the ASP.NET Blog. Startup.cs/ConfigureServices: "services.AddTransient<ISchollService, SchollService> ()" ile servise yaplan her arda yeni bir SchollService oluturulur. In this article, you will learn about swagger in .NET Core. Both Swashbuckle and NSwag include an embedded version of Swagger UI, so that it can be hosted in your ASP.NET Core app using a middleware registration call. swagger "No operations defined in spec!" after using Django namespaceversioning for api.